Fast food is less nutritious than meals prepared at home, but cooking often drops to the bottom of the daily priority list. The Cook Smart Eat Smart Cooking School with instructor Julie Sawyer will focus on meal preparation from start to finish using basic equipment, simple ingredients and healthy cooking techniques.
Sawyer is a Family & Consumer Sciences Agent with Haywood County Cooperative Extension and will be joined by fellow agents from neighboring counties. Free. Register at go.ncsu.edu/virtualcses.
